intel/dump_gpu: further track mapping of BOs
We can go further in tracking what BOs are written to by the driver by tracking when a buffer in unmapped. A BO could be mmap, written, unmap and never be written to again. In such case we can just write the BO's content on the first exec buf after unmap and never write it again.
